About WEC Energy Group
WEC Energy Group is a public utility holding company that provides electric and natural gas service to nearly 4.4 million customers. It operates across Wisconsin, Illinois, Michigan, and Minnesota through several regulated utility subsidiaries. The company manages extensive infrastructure including 70,000 miles of electric distribution lines and 44,000 miles of natural gas lines. Founded in 2015, the firm maintains headquarters in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, and employs between 5,001 and 10,000 people.
